It would help if you included the lab ref ranges and any medication/doses and supplements you're taking.

Your thyroid result I assume is TSH? If so, it looks high enough to make you feel very unwell, but not necessarily high enough to consider treatment.

B12 looks ok given that the range is usually 190-900. Having said that, serum test is notoriously inaccurate and you may only be utilising 20% in your cells. Mine has doubled to 725 but I intend to continue supplementing until it is higher.

Your vitD is below optimal and your GP should repeat the injection or prescribe a high dose maintenance regime until it is optimal >75.

I think your cholesterol is on the high side and this is consistent with hypothyroidism. Optimal levothyroxine medication would probably bring down your cholesterol.

You would be treated for hypothyroidism in most of Europe and USA with TSH >3. Unfortunately, some GPs won't treat in UK until it is >5 with auto-immune antibodies, or >10 without antibodies.

You can restate your symptoms and request a trial period of Levothyroxine at 75/100mcg. Less than 50mcg may not be worth having as it may inhibit your own production of FT4 leaving you feeling worse.
